WebJun 16, 2016 · This paper studies the cross-sectional risk–return trade-off in the stock market. A fundamental principle in finance is the positive relation between risk and expected return. However, recent empirical evidence suggests the opposite. Using several intuitive risk measures, we show that the negative risk–return relation is much more pronounced … Webcover a positive risk-return relation. In the same vein, Ludvigson and Ng (2007) show that including factors in the ICAPM equation leads to a positive relation between risk and return. Finally, the literature review by Lettau and Ludvigson (2010) emphasizes the importance of conditioning variables in the estimation of the risk-return trade-off.
